Output 95e71c76ccbfa49495e23a73ddb95d5e1dc7aec0942e9acd2860687cc59b4e16:1

value
5016651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b8d91c0c2d0f6a0a8e0edf778a0ed56e60627a OP_EQUAL
address
3JMALviVNeyELPeMbKXLpVx9LoZ1cJnkNd
transaction
95e71c76ccbfa49495e23a73ddb95d5e1dc7aec0942e9acd2860687cc59b4e16
spent
true